Charjew vs Nakhon Si Thammarat Climate & Distance Between

Thailand flag
  • The distance between Charjew, Turkmenistan and Nakhon Si Thammarat, Thailand is approximately 4,960 km or 3,082 mi.
  • To reach Charjew in this distance one would set out from Nakhon Si Thammarat bearing 319.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Charjew bearing 303.4° or WNW .
  • Charjew has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Nakhon Si Thammarat has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• Charjew is in or near the warm temperate desert biome whereas Nakhon Si Thammarat is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 11.8 °C (21.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.8 °C (46.4°F) more in Charjew.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2259.1 mm (88.9 in) less which is equivalent to 2259.1 l/m² (55.44 US gal/ft²) or 22,591,000 l/ha (2,415,128 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23° lower in Charjew than in Nakhon Si Thammarat.
